What's in the feed now

Tax year 2024 — spent $138,037 more than it took in. Revenue $4,357,514 · expenses $4,495,551 · reserve months 3.1
Tax year 2023 — took in $420,039 more than it spent. Revenue $5,668,946 · expenses $5,248,907 · reserve months 3.0
Tax year 2022 — took in $240,818 more than it spent. Revenue $4,937,387 · expenses $4,696,569 · reserve months 2.3
Tax year 2021 — took in $272,873 more than it spent. Revenue $2,972,865 · expenses $2,699,992 · reserve months 2.9
Tax year 2020 — took in $103,900 more than it spent. Revenue $2,297,637 · expenses $2,193,737 · reserve months 2.0
Tax year 2019 — took in $23,068 more than it spent. Revenue $1,533,820 · expenses $1,510,752 · reserve months 2.1
Tax year 2018 — took in $60,673 more than it spent. Revenue $1,496,046 · expenses $1,435,373 · reserve months 2.1
Tax year 2017 — took in $4,082 more than it spent. Revenue $1,251,763 · expenses $1,247,681 · reserve months 1.8
Tax year 2016 — took in $30,152 more than it spent. Revenue $916,981 · expenses $886,829 · reserve months 2.5
Tax year 2015 — took in $108,111 more than it spent. Revenue $976,803 · expenses $868,692 · reserve months 2.1
Tax year 2014 — spent $8,327 more than it took in. Revenue $664,964 · expenses $673,291 · reserve months 0.8
Tax year 2013 — spent $79,103 more than it took in. Revenue $320,362 · expenses $399,465 · reserve months 1.6
Tax year 2012 — took in $43,024 more than it spent. Revenue $370,690 · expenses $327,666 · reserve months 4.8
Tax year 2011 — took in $48,591 more than it spent. Revenue $185,617 · expenses $137,026 · reserve months 7.8
Tax year 2010 — took in $40,185 more than it spent. Revenue $57,400 · expenses $17,215 · reserve months 28.0
